From f6785ec9770f28951263a5263f6e566681eb98c2 Mon Sep 17 00:00:00 2001 From: Juan Velez Date: Fri, 23 Aug 2019 08:25:06 -0700 Subject: [PATCH] Added missing argument when calling extension method equals --- _sips/sips/2012-01-30-value-classes.md |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/_sips/sips/2012-01-30-value-classes.md b/_sips/sips/2012-01-30-value-classes.md index cf8ac211db..35ad090bc1 100644 --- a/_sips/sips/2012-01-30-value-classes.md +++ b/_sips/sips/2012-01-30-value-classes.md @@ -163,7 +163,7 @@ In our example, the `Meter` class would be expanded as follows: override def toString: String = Meter.extension$toString(this) override def equals(other: Any) = - Meter.extension$equals(this) + Meter.extension$equals(this, other) override def hashCode = Meter.extension$hashCode(this) } @@ -333,7 +333,7 @@ After all 4 steps the `Meter` class is translated to the following code. override def toString: String = Meter.extension$toString(this.underlying) override def equals(other: Any) = - Meter.extension$equals(this) + Meter.extension$equals(this, other) override def hashCode = Meter.extension$hashCode(this) }